What’s your pick-of-the-week or tip-of-the-week?
My pick of the week is an app called Money Manager. It’s a very simple app that allows you to track your expenses and label them with minimalist icons. It also displays your expenses in a pie chart, and you can export them to an excel spreadsheet.
